AI Technical Summary

Technical Problem

The lack of shielding on existing flatbed trolleys used in logistics warehousing causes goods to shake and fall during transportation, resulting in damage.

Method used

A cargo flatbed truck for logistics warehousing was designed, equipped with a shielding frame and adjustment components, including a threaded rod, a worm gear, a worm, and a handwheel. The handwheel drives the worm to move the worm gear and the threaded rod, thereby adjusting the extension plate. Combined with magnets to fix the loading plate, the shielding effect is enhanced.

Benefits of technology

It effectively prevents goods from shaking due to road impacts during transportation, reduces the risk of damage, improves applicability and ease of operation, and reduces labor intensity.

Abstract

A goods flat car for logistics storage comprises a plate body, a pushing handle is fixedly connected to the rear portion of the upper side wall of the plate body, and universal wheels are installed at the four corners of the lower side wall of the plate body respectively. Compared with the prior art, the goods transportation device has the advantages that goods in transportation can be shielded through the shielding frame and the extension plate, the situation that the goods shake left and right due to the impact force of a road surface and fall off to be damaged is avoided, the worm can be driven to rotate by rotating the hand wheel, the worm can drive the threaded rod to rotate through rotation of the worm, and when the threaded rod rotates, the goods are not damaged. Under the action of a threaded groove, an extension plate can move upwards and stretch out of a shielding frame, so that the stretching length of the extension plate can be adjusted according to the stacking height of goods, the applicability is higher, the practicability is higher, if the goods are heavy, a goods feeding plate can be opened, the goods are pushed to the goods feeding plate, the goods can be pushed to a plate body more conveniently through arrangement of a rotating roller, and the practicability is higher. Lifting is not needed, more labor is saved, and the labor intensity is reduced.

Description

TECHNICAL FIELD

[0001] The utility model relates to the transportation tool technology field for logistics and storage, especially relates to a goods flat car for logistics and storage. BACKGROUND

[0002] Logistics is a part of supply chain activities, is for satisfying customer needs and the high efficiency, low cost flow and storage of goods, service consumption and related information from the place of production to the place of consumption are carried out planning, implementation and control process. Logistics is centered on warehousing, promotes production and market to keep synchronization. Logistics is to meet the needs of customers, with the lowest cost, through transportation, storage, distribution and other ways, realizes the planning, implementation and management of raw materials, semi-finished products, finished products and related information from the place of production to the place of consumption of goods.

[0003] Through the retrieval of the patent with the disclosure number CN108974070A of China, a kind of flat cart for logistics and storage is disclosed, including bottom plate, hinge hinge, cross plate, limit slot and handrail, the bottom plate lower end is installed with mobile wheel, the lower end both sides of bottom plate are provided with guide frame, and support block is installed in guide frame, the hinge hinge is fixed in the upper end both sides of bottom plate, and hinge hinge other end is fixedly connected with cross plate, the limit slot is opened in the inside of bottom plate, and limit slot and limit rod one end are clamped connection, the other end of limit rod is installed in the left end below of the storage board by first rotator, the right end of storage board and handrail are provided with second rotator, the inside of handrail is installed with reinforcing plate, and handrail is fixedly installed in the right side of bottom plate.

[0004] The prior art in the above has the following disadvantages: the trolley does not have the function of shielding the transported goods, and the goods will sway left and right due to the impact of the road during transportation, which is easy to fall and cause damage to the goods, and is inconvenient to use. UTILITY MODEL CONTENT

[0005] In view of the above shortcomings in the prior art, the utility model provides a goods flat car for logistics and storage to solve the problems in the above background art.

[0006] In order to achieve the above utility model purposes, the utility model adopts the technical scheme of a goods flat car for logistics and storage, which comprises a plate body, a pushing handle is fixedly connected to the upper side wall of the plate body at the rear, universal wheels are installed at the four corners of the lower side wall of the plate body, a shielding frame is fixedly connected to the upper side wall of the plate body on both sides, an extension plate is arranged in the shielding frame, a threaded groove is formed in the lower side wall of the extension plate, and an adjusting assembly is arranged in the shielding frame.

[0007] As the improvement: the adjusting assembly includes a threaded rod, a worm wheel, a worm and a hand wheel, the lower inner wall of the shielding frame is rotationally connected with the threaded rod, the upper end of the threaded rod extends into the threaded groove and is threadedly connected with the threaded groove, the lower end of the threaded rod is fixedly connected with the worm wheel, the worm is rotationally connected between the two inner walls of the shielding frame, one end of the worm penetrates through the shielding frame and is fixedly connected with the hand wheel, and the worm wheel and the worm are in meshing connection.

[0008] As the improvement: the front side wall of the plate body is hingedly connected with a loading plate, and notches are formed in the loading plate, and a plurality of rotating rollers are rotationally connected between the two side walls of the notches.

[0009] As the improvement: T-shaped sliding grooves are formed in the front and rear inner walls of the shielding frame, and T-shaped sliding rails that are matched with the T-shaped sliding grooves are fixedly connected to the front and rear walls of the extension plate.

[0010] As the improvement: a first magnet is mounted on the front outer wall of the shielding frame, and a second magnet that is matched with the first magnet is fixedly connected to the upper wall of the loading plate.

[0011] Compared with the prior art, the utility model has the advantages of:

[0012] 1. The shielding frame and the extension plate can shield the goods in transportation, avoid the goods from shaking left and right due to the impact of the road surface, and cause damage due to falling, the hand wheel can drive the worm to rotate, the worm can drive the worm wheel to rotate, and the extension plate will move upwards under the action of the threaded groove when the threaded rod rotates, and the extension plate will extend from the shielding frame, so that the length of the extension plate can be adjusted according to the stacking height of the goods, the applicability is higher, and the utility model is more practical, if the goods are heavy, the loading plate can be opened, the goods can be pushed onto the loading plate, and the rotating rollers can conveniently push the goods onto the plate body without lifting, so that the labor intensity is reduced. [0021] like Figure 1 As shown, a flatbed truck for logistics warehousing includes a flatbed 1. A push handle 1.1 is fixedly connected to the rear of the upper side wall of the flatbed 1 to facilitate pushing the flatbed 1 to move. Universal wheels 1.2 are installed at the four corners of the lower side wall of the flatbed 1. A shielding frame 1.3 is fixedly connected to both sides of the upper side wall of the flatbed 1. An extension plate 1.4 is provided inside the shielding frame 1.3. The shielding frame 1.3 and the extension plate 1.4 can shield the goods during transportation to prevent the goods from swaying from side to side due to the impact of the road surface, which could cause them to fall and be damaged. A threaded groove 1.42 is opened on the lower side wall of the extension plate 1.4. An adjustment component 2 is provided inside the shielding frame 1.3.

[0022] Specifically, such as Figure 2 and Figure 3As shown, the logistics storage goods flat car, adjusting assembly 2 includes threaded rod 2.1, worm gear 2.2, worm 2.3 and hand wheel 2.4, the lower side of the inner wall of the shielding frame 1.3 is rotatably connected with threaded rod 2.1, the upper end of the threaded rod 2.1 extends into the threaded groove 1.42 and is threadedly connected with the threaded groove 1.42, the lower end of the threaded rod 2.1 is fixedly connected with the worm gear 2.2, the worm 2.3 is rotatably connected between the two side walls of the shielding frame 1.3, one end of the worm 2.3 passes through the shielding frame 1.3 and is fixedly connected with the hand wheel 2.4, the worm gear 2.2 and the worm 2.3 are engaged, rotating the hand wheel 2.4 can drive the worm 2.3 to rotate, the worm 2.3 rotates can make the worm gear 2.2 drive the threaded rod 2.1 to rotate, when the threaded rod 2.1 rotates, under the action of the threaded groove 1.42, the extension plate 1.4 will move upwards, from the shielding frame 1.3, so that the length of the extension plate 1.4 can be adjusted according to the stacking height of the goods, higher applicability, more practical.

[0023] Specifically, as shown in the drawings, Figure 1 The logistics storage goods flat car, the front side wall of the plate body 1 is hingedly connected with the loading plate 3, the loading plate 3 is provided with a notch 3.1, a plurality of rotating rollers 3.2 are rotatably connected between the two side walls of the notch 3.1, the first magnet 1.32 on the shielding frame 1.3 and the second magnet 3.3 on the loading plate 3 are separated by pulling the loading plate 3 slightly, the loading plate 3 rotates along the hinge point and touches the ground, then the goods are pushed onto the loading plate 3, the rotating rollers 3.2 can make it more convenient to push the goods onto the plate body 1 without lifting, which is more labor-saving and reduces labor intensity.

[0024] Specifically, as shown in the drawings, Figure 2 The logistics storage goods flat car, T-shaped sliding grooves 1.31 are formed on the front and rear inner walls of the shielding frame 1.3, T-shaped sliding rails 1.41 adapted to the T-shaped sliding grooves 1.31 are fixedly connected to the front and rear walls of the extension plate 1.4, when the extension plate 1.4 moves up and down, the T-shaped sliding rails 1.41 slide in the T-shaped sliding grooves 1.31, making the extension plate 1.4 move up and down more stably.

[0025] Specifically, as shown in the drawings, Figure 1 The logistics storage goods flat car, a first magnet 1.32 is installed on the front outer wall of the shielding frame 1.3, second magnets 3.3 adapted to the first magnet 1.32 are fixedly connected to the upper side walls of the loading plate 3, the first magnet 1.32 can be attracted to the second magnet 3.3, so that the loading plate 3 is fixed between the two shielding frames 1.3.

[0026] The utility model discloses a push-pull handle 1.1 is pushed to the board body 1, and then the goods are stacked, when encountering heavy goods, slightly pull the loading plate 3 with force, make the first magnet 1.32 on the shielding frame 1.3 and the second magnet 3.3 on the loading plate 3 separate, and the loading plate 3 rotates along the hinge point and lands, then push the goods to the loading plate 3, and the setting of rotating roller 3.2 can more conveniently push the goods to the board body 1, need not lift, is more laborsaving, reduces the labor intensity, after stacking the goods well, push the push-pull handle 1.1 and make the board body 1 move, and the setting of shielding frame 1.3 and extension plate 1.4 can shield the goods in transportation, avoid the goods left and right sway due to the impact of road surface, cause to drop and cause damage, can also rotate hand wheel 2.4 and drive worm 2.3 to rotate, and worm 2.3 rotates can make worm wheel 2.2 drive screw rod 2.1 to rotate, when screw rod 2.1 rotates, under the action of screw groove 1.42, extension plate 1.4 will move upwards, from shielding frame 1.3 extends, thereby can adjust the length that extension plate 1.4 extends according to the accumulation height of goods, and the applicability is higher, is more practical.
